Congratulations to five local restaurants honored for their wine programs by Wine Spectator magazine, including three first-time honorees. Table 128, RoCA and Splash join perennial choices 801 Chophouse and Fleming’s among recipients of awards listed in the magazine’s July issue.

Table 128, RoCA and Splash receive the magazine’s “Award of Excellence,” indicating that they typically offer at least 90 selections and feature a well-chosen assortment of quality producers, along with a thematic match to the menu in both price and style. 801 Chophouse has once again received the “Best of Award of Excellence” designation, indicating that they typically offer 350 or more selections and are a destination for serious wine lovers, showing a deep commitment to wine, both in the cellar and through their service team.
